在当今数字化浪潮下,社区系统开发已成为企业构建用户粘性、提升运营效率的重要抓手。无论是物业公司搭建智慧社区平台,还是品牌方打造用户互动生态,一套高效、稳定且可扩展的社区系统都至关重要。然而,许多企业在启动项目时往往低估了开发流程的复杂性,导致周期延长、预算超支甚至功能无法满足实际需求。因此,系统化梳理社区系统开发的全流程,不仅有助于规避常见陷阱,更能为项目的顺利落地奠定坚实基础。
项目启动与目标设定
社区系统开发的第一步是明确项目定位与核心目标。企业需结合自身业务场景,厘清系统要解决的核心问题:是提升业主报修响应速度?增强邻里互动?还是实现会员积分与活动联动?只有精准定义目标,才能避免“为了做系统而做系统”的误区。此时,建议组建跨职能团队,包括产品、技术、运营及市场人员,共同参与需求初筛。通过召开启动会,统一各方对系统愿景的理解,确保后续工作方向一致。这一阶段的关键在于“聚焦”,切忌功能贪多求全,应优先保障核心模块的可用性与用户体验。
需求分析与用户画像构建
在目标明确后,进入需求分析环节。这一步不仅是收集功能点,更需深入理解真实用户行为。例如,老年业主可能更关注一键报修与物业通知推送,年轻家庭则重视社区活动报名与亲子互动板块。通过问卷调研、用户访谈、竞品分析等方式,绘制出清晰的用户画像,并据此划分不同角色权限与使用路径。值得注意的是,社区系统开发中常被忽视的是“非功能性需求”,如系统并发承载能力、数据加密标准、移动端适配度等,这些直接影响后期运维成本与用户信任度。建议采用原型图或低保真界面进行需求验证,尽早发现逻辑漏洞,降低返工风险。

技术选型与架构设计
技术选型直接决定了系统的可维护性与扩展性。对于中小型社区项目,基于React/Vue的前后端分离架构搭配MySQL或PostgreSQL数据库,已能满足大多数场景。若涉及高频消息推送或实时互动(如直播、弹幕),可引入WebSocket或第三方云服务(如阿里云短信/极光推送)。同时,考虑未来接入小程序、H5页面或第三方支付接口的可能性,在架构设计时预留标准化接口。安全方面,必须启用HTTPS协议,对敏感数据进行脱敏处理,并定期进行渗透测试。良好的技术选型不仅能缩短开发周期,也为后期迭代提供灵活空间。
开发实施与敏捷管理
进入开发阶段,推荐采用敏捷开发模式,将整个社区系统开发拆分为若干个2-4周的迭代周期。每个周期聚焦特定功能模块,如“用户注册登录”“公告发布”“报修流程闭环”等。通过每日站会同步进度,每轮迭代结束后进行小范围测试与反馈收集,确保交付成果符合预期。在此过程中,代码质量控制尤为重要,建议引入Git版本管理、Code Review机制及自动化测试工具。此外,针对社区系统开发中常见的“功能堆积”问题,应坚持“最小可行产品(MVP)”原则,先上线核心功能,再根据用户反馈逐步优化。
测试与上线部署
测试环节是保障系统稳定性的最后一道防线。除了常规的功能测试外,还需重点开展压力测试(模拟大量用户同时操作)、兼容性测试(覆盖主流手机型号与浏览器)以及安全审计。特别是对于涉及用户隐私信息的模块,如身份认证、缴费记录查询等,必须通过严格的安全扫描。当所有测试项通过后,方可进入灰度发布阶段——先向部分试点用户开放,观察系统表现并收集反馈。待无重大缺陷后,再全面上线。上线初期建议安排专人值守,及时响应突发问题,确保用户体验不受影响。
后期维护与持续迭代
系统上线并非终点,而是新起点。社区系统开发完成后,仍需投入资源进行日常维护,包括服务器监控、补丁更新、数据库优化等。更重要的是,建立一套可持续的运营机制,如定期策划线上活动、优化内容推荐算法、引入激励体系以提升用户活跃度。根据用户行为数据,识别高价值功能与低使用率模块,动态调整产品策略。同时,保持与用户的沟通渠道畅通,鼓励反馈意见,形成良性循环。唯有如此,才能真正构建一个有生命力的社区生态。
我们专注于社区系统开发领域多年,深耕于H5开发、前端设计与后端架构优化,积累了丰富的实战经验,尤其擅长从零搭建可落地、易扩展的社区运营平台。无论是物业智慧管理、品牌私域社群建设,还是大型社区生态系统的整合,我们都能够提供定制化解决方案,助力企业实现高效运营与用户增长。18140119082
联系电话:18140119082(微信同号)